                  Put a new pump on the rear washer, nearly **** at the price, stealership item, 72 freakin dollars for miserable little pump that is worth maybe all of 5 bucks. I had a water leak that filled up the rear wheel well and screwed the pump.

                  I relocated the washer bottle above the trunk floor so that won't happen again.

                  Stupid place to have it in the first place.
